The Influence of Temperature on Paint Application



When you're planning a commercial outside painting job, the temperature can significantly affect how well the paint sticks and dries out.

Preferably, you wish to repaint when temperature levels range in between 50 ° F and 85 ° F. If it's too cold, the paint may not treat correctly, leading to issues like peeling off or splitting.

On the other hand, if it's too warm, the paint can dry out also quickly, preventing appropriate attachment and resulting in an uneven coating.

Humidity and Its Result on Drying Times



Temperature isn't the only environmental factor that influences your commercial exterior painting job; moisture plays a significant function also. High humidity levels can decrease drying out times substantially, impacting the general quality of your paint work.



When the air is saturated with moisture, the paint takes longer to heal, which can lead to problems like inadequate bond and a higher danger of mold development. If you're repainting on a particularly humid day, be gotten ready for extensive delay times between layers.

It's critical to monitor regional weather conditions and plan as necessary. Ideally, aim for moisture degrees between 40% and 70% for optimum drying out.

Best Seasons for Commercial Outside Paint Projects



What's the very best season for your business exterior paint jobs?

Springtime and very early loss are usually your best bets. Throughout these seasons, temperature levels are mild, and humidity levels are usually reduced, creating optimal conditions for paint application and drying out.

Stay clear of summertime's intense heat, which can cause paint to dry also quickly, resulting in poor bond and surface. Similarly, wintertime's cool temperature levels can hinder correct drying and healing, taking the chance of the durability of your paint job.
